Introduction
Working with public, private and community organisations, we apply a range of science-based, digital modelling tools to the process of architectural design and urban planning, taking a principled, human-focused approach. From strategic spatial models that provide a rapid, robust picture of mobility and location hierarchy, to micro-simulations and Integrated Urban Models that use AI techniques to explore social, economic and environmental datasets, our objective is the creation of thriving life in buildings and urban places. In doing so, we help people see, in clear and straightforward terms, how space can be designed to optimise its human and natural performance.
Through a longitudinal programme of internal research and international academic collaboration, we continuously develop our digital technologies and design methods.
In parallel with project-based applications, we disseminate the Space Syntax Approach by providing training that is tailored to client needs, ranging from short CPD sessions to multi-year programmes.

Training course_Interconnected places
A non-technical, self-guided training course on the Space Syntax approach. Learn how systems thinking and spatial network analysis can explain how cities work. For city leaders, policymakers, architects and urban planners to gain new insights into how street networks influence everyday activities: mobility, interaction, collaboration and trade.
